About Ju-Chien Cheng

Ju-Chien Cheng is a scholar working on Immunology and Allergy, Pharmacology and Hematology, having authored 23 papers that have together received 747 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Platelet Disorders and Treatments (6 papers), Phytochemistry and Bioactivity Studies (5 papers) and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ology and Allergy (73 citations), Pharmacology (85 citations) and Hematology (86 citations). Ju-Chien Cheng has collaborated with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and Poland. Frequent co-authors include Ching‐Ping Tseng, Chien‐Ling Huang, Shy-Shin Chang, Chih‐Hua Chao, Tian-Shung Wu, Arnold Stern, De-Yang Shen, Yi-Chih Chang, Hsiao‐Ling Chen and Chuan‐Mu Chen.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Nature Communications and Circulation Research.
